First Things First: Shut Off the Water

Imagine it’s a peaceful evening, and suddenly, you hear the dreadful sound of water gushing. Before panic sets in, act swiftly. Turn off the main water supply immediately. This can usually be found near the water meter. Stopping water flow limits the damage and buys you time to think about your next steps. Consider this your first line of defence, because water can cause a lot of chaos if uncontrolled.

Assess and Contain the Damage

Once the water is off, it’s time to assess the situation. Carefully inspect the affected area to understand the severity of the burst. Is the water causing more damage to your furniture, floors, or walls? Use towels or a mop to soak up as much water as possible. If the water level is substantial, a wet vacuum could be a lifesaver. Try to move any valuable or sensitive items to a dry place to safeguard them from water damage.

Drain the Remaining Water

Even after the main supply is turned off, there may still be water left in your pipes. Turn on all taps and flush toilets to drain any residual water. This step can also help relieve pressure on the damaged pipe, stopping more water from leaking out. Think of it as clearing out the remaining troops after the main battle; you want to avoid any more casualties.

Document the Damage

Insurance claims can be tricky, and it’s crucial to have clear evidence of the damage. Take photos or videos of the affected areas, and make detailed notes. Keep any receipts from emergency services or repairs. This documentation will be invaluable when you file a claim with your insurance provider. It provides a clear, indisputable record of what happened, helping to expedite the process.

Temporary Repairs

If you’re waiting for a plumber and need to prevent additional damage, you can perform some temporary fixes. Epoxy putty or pipe clamps can work wonders in a pinch. These are short-term solutions but can help mitigate the situation until professional help arrives. Just remember, they are not substitutes for a proper repair by a licensed plumber.

Preventative Measures

After dealing with a burst pipe, you’re likely to be more vigilant to avoid a repeat performance. Consider installing pipe insulation, especially in colder months, to prevent your pipes from freezing and bursting. Regular maintenance and inspections can catch potential issues before they become major problems.
